Q: Is 679,419 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 679,419 is a composite number.

Why is 679,419 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 679,419 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 13 39 117 5,807 17,421 52,263 75,491 226,473 and 679,419, with no remainder.

Since 679,419 cannot be divided by just 1 and 679,419, it is a composite number.
